Lewis (Youghal)

In 1860 the Duke of Devonshire sold his estate in and adjacent to the town of Youghal to David Leopold Lewis of London for £60,000. Lewis appears to have been unable to pay for the estate until two years later. Portions were sold in the Landed Estates Court in May 1868 and others advertised for sale again in the Landed Estates' Court in September of that year. The Irish Times contains a detailed account of purchasers in the May sale. The Duke's transactions with D.L. Lewis are well documented in the Lismore Papers.
